Cracked foundation repair services focus on identifying and addressing issues related to damage or deterioration in a building’s foundation. These services typically involve thorough inspections to assess the extent of the damage, followed by the implementation of appropriate repair methods. Common techniques include underpinning, slab jacking, pier installation, and stabilization to restore the foundation’s integrity. The goal is to prevent further deterioration and to ensure the stability and safety of the structure.

Foundation problems often result from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or construction practices, or aging materials. These issues can lead to cracks in walls,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and other structural concerns. Repair services aim to correct these problems by stabilizing the foundation, filling and sealing cracks, and reinforcing weak areas. Addressing foundation issues promptly can also help prevent more extensive damage that could compromise the safety of the property or lead to costly repairs in the future.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ive work can reach higher figures.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ific foundation issues.

Repair Method Expenses - Different repair methods influence costs, with underpinning averaging between $3,000 and $10,000. Helical piers or wall stabilization tend to fall within this range, but prices vary based on the project's complexity.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.

Material and Labor Costs - Material costs for foundation repair typically account for 40-60% of the total expense, with labor making up the rest. For a typical project in Winnetka, IL, expenses can range from $4,000 to $15,000. Local contractors can assess the specific needs of each property.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, excavation, or drainage improvements, which can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the overall price. These factors depend on the property's condition and local regulations. Pros can provide detailed cost breakdowns during consultations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, wall anchors, or underpinning, depending on the severity and type of crack.

Can a small crack in the foundation be a serious problem? Yes, even small cracks can indicate underlying issues and may require assessment and repair by a professional contractor.

How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age but often ranges from a few days to a week.
